Kinderlou Forest Golf Club is an 18-hole golf course in Valdosta, GA with a par of 72. It offers 5 tee sets: green (7,231 yards, slope 138, rating 74.9), blue (6,479 yards, slope 127, rating 71.2), white (5,899 yards, slope 121, rating 68.9), gold (5,230 yards, slope 114, rating 65.7), black (4,715 yards, slope 108, rating 63.5). The hardest hole is #4, a par 5 playing 591 yards from the first tee.
